[INTVideo] internal video setting screen

Colors are selected using the rotary 2 control. There are 10
choices: White, Yellow, Cyan, Green, Magenta, Red, Blue,
Black, Custom1 and Custom2.
The color level (Y level for White) is set using the rotary 3
control. When [Custom1] or [Custom2] has been selected,
either Back Matte or Wash is set.
[Pattern] (gradation pattern) is set using the rotary 4 control.
There are the following nine choices.

[Off]

: No gradation

[H1]

: Horizontal gradation 1

[H2]

: Horizontal gradation 2

[H3]

: Horizontal gradation 3

[V1]

: Vertical gradation 1

[V2]

: Vertical gradation 2

[V3]

: Vertical gradation 3

[Diag1] : Diagonal gradation 1
[Diag2] : Diagonal gradation 2

The [Grade] combined gradation level is set using the rotary
5 control. Any value from 0 to 255 can be set. The
gradation position is set using [Shift] + rotary 5 control.

When [Back Matte] has been selected

The joystick XY and rotary Z control displays are set to Wash, and the wash color that is the companion color for gradation is
set.
The joystick [X][Y] and rotary [Z] display change to [Pb], [Pr] and [Y], and the color can be set. [Pb][Pr] can be set to any
value from 0 to 255 and [Y] to any value from 16 to 255 but only when [Custom1] or [Custom2] has been selected using
rotary 2 control.

When [Custom1, 2] has been selected

The rotary 3 control is used to select whether BackM (back
matte) or Wash is to be set using the joystick. With Set
BackM, the joystick XY and rotary Z control at the top of the
screen appear as “Matte,” and with Set Wash, they appear
as “Wash,” enabling the respective colors to be adjusted.
The default color for Custom1 and Custom2 is black.
